Compare car hire types in Tsukuba

  • Small: Including classes like mini and economy, this cheap rental car in Tsukuba puts you on the road for less. These zippy, fuel-efficient cars are perfect for short trips and city driving.

  • Medium: Not too small, not too big, it's the definition of just right. Typically including compact and intermediate cars, they strike a balance of fuel efficiency and interior space and are great for couples and small families.

  • Large: Offering a more comfortable driving experience and advanced tech features, this Tsukuba car hire category includes full-size cars. With larger back seats and ample storage space, they let you load up and transport everyone, and everything, with ease.

  • SUV: SUVs are made for plans that change mid-journey. All-wheel drive and everyday versatility equip them for urban streets and country routes alike.

  • Van: With options like commercial vans and trucks, this category of car for rent in Tsukuba makes light work of big hauls and group travel. They're spacious, functional, and ready to tackle whatever task lies ahead.

Good to know

  • Rental age requirements aren't the same everywhere. Companies can set their own policies, and if you're under the minimum age, you could face extra fees or restrictions. Check what applies with each supplier before booking your car rental in Japan.

  • Add a car seat to your Tsukuba car rental reservation if you're bringing the kids. Regulations change from one place to another, but using a child seat suited to their size and age is always the safest option.

  • You'll be asked to provide some documents when you get to the rental counter. As a rule, bring your physical driver's licence, a credit card with enough funds for the excess (debit cards usually aren't accepted), and another form of photo ID. Your booking confirmation will spell it all out.

  • Driving in Japan can seem unfamiliar if it's your first time. Be aware that traffic travels on the left side of the road.

  • Local speed limits can vary, but it's usually around 55kph in urban areas and 85kph or so on highways. Always go with what's posted on the road signs.

  • In Japan, the legal blood alcohol concentration (BAC) limit is 0.03%. If you intend to have a couple of drinks, pass the keys to someone else or take another form of transport.

  • One of the busiest times to be out on the roads in this destination is around 8am. Make life easier by steering clear of rush hours in general.

  • You'll be using the Japanese yen (JPY) for all your purchases here. You may find it useful to carry a mix of cards and cash to ensure you're covered in all situations.
